All Downloads are FREE. Search and download functionalities are using the official Maven repository.

cn.featherfly.rc.Configuration Maven / Gradle / Ivy


package cn.featherfly.rc;

import java.io.Serializable;

/**
 * 

* 配置接口. *

* @author 钟冀 */ public interface Configuration { /** *

* 获取配置对象名称 *

* @return 配置对象名称 */ String getName(); /** *

* 获取当前配置对象的描述 *

* @return 配置对象描述 */ // String getDescp(); /** *

* 获取指定配置 *

* @param name 配置名称 * @param type 值类型 * @param 泛型 * @return 值 */ V get(String name, Class type); /** *

* 设置指定配置 *

* @param name 配置名称 * @param value 值 * @param 泛型 * @return this */ Configuration set(String name, V value); }




© 2015 - 2025 Weber Informatics LLC | Privacy Policy